Cam question

I currently have something of a hotcam or cc305 not sure it was in the car when i bought it. It has mildly ported heads and full bolt ons. The car put down 340rwhp and close to the same in torque. I have talked to LE a couple times but am still undecided if i should go with a stage 3 setup or just put a bigger cam and different springs and see what she does. It is not a daily driver but i do put quite a few miles on it. I would really like to see 425rwhp but i know that wont happen with just a cam change, is it possible to hit 400 by just doing that? If so what cam should i go with

Re: Cam question

400 rwhp would be pretty hard to get with just "mildly ported" heads. Cant really know unless we know exactly what was done to the heads. I would go with the le2 setup if you still drive it quite abit. That should net you over 400 rwhp.

Re: Cam question

Having the heads flowed would be an excellent idea. If they are good enough for you goals just send the flow numbers to a cam guy and get a custom cam. If they are now good enough, the flow cart will help greatly when it comes time to sell them and get the le3.
